The DSC program is a grassroots channel through which Google provides development skills, mobile and web development skills for students, towards employability.
For students to learn development skills, solve problems through technology and inspire them to be world class developers and changemakers.
DSC activities are targeted at University students and any others including faculty members who want to learn development skills & work to solve real-life problems.

Google I/O is an annual developer conference held by Google in Mountain View, California. I/O was inaugurated in 2008, and is organized by the executive team. "I/O" stands for input/output, as well as the slogan "Innovation in the Open". The event's format is similar to Google Developer Day.

Study Jams are community-run study groups for developers. This is a great opportunity to bring members of the community together to learn something in person. These trainings give developers a specific skill they can use for personal development or career advancement.
